Job Description:
Client Expatriate Mobility Specialist provides hands-on and consultative services to the business, including full lifecycle support for Expatriates employees on rotational, short and long-term assignment, domestic relocation, and US entry support.
This role will be responsible for driving, executing and leading communications for Expatriates HR related support during their assignment in the US.

Role and Responsibilities:
• Provide expertise on Expatriate Mobility benefits and policies.
• Coordinate and support Client Expatriates' immigration and relocation process by partnering with internal stakeholders (i.e., Immigration, Talent Acquisition, Total Rewards, Finance, IT, Payroll, Accounts Payable, Law Firms) to ensure a smooth and efficient employee experience.
• Maintain expatriate personnel documents, a variety of benefit-related data, and files with specific attention to detail.
• Serve as a resource to HR, Legal, Finance, HQ, and external CPA for inquiries related to Expats.
• Work closely with NAHR Expatriate to problem-solve on individual Expats cases and systemic inquiries, as needed.
• The expatriate's primary point of contact for all HR related support matters.
• Support with ad-hoc requests and special projects assigned by management.
• Serve as back-up for all expat related matters including but not limited to I-9 support, onboarding, benefits, transition, relocation, mobility program, and data management.
• Support the event planner in facilitating and coordinating year-round events for expats including in-house or external seminars and recreation activities.
• Support data management and reporting to C-suite
• Prepare and submit invoices for expat related expenses to finance and account payable teams.
• Proactively seek out ways in which to improve the expatriate experience
• Provide back-up support for PERM process across the region

Skills and Qualifications:
• Minimum of 2-3 years of combined experience in HR, or in the related field.
• Bachelor's degree, preferably in Human Resources, Business, Psychology, or related field.
• Must be able to ensure a high degree of discretion and confidentiality.
• Ability to maintain ownership of projects, willingness to take initiative, and flexibility to create & accept challenge and innovation are particularly important.
• Customer service focus and strong interpersonal skills required.
• Develop and maintain excellent working relationships with all appropriate executive levels within the company, local community, and critical industry contacts.
• Read, write, prepare, and translate executive materials, presentations, contracts, or related documents.
• Ability to work in a time-sensitive environment while working on multiple priorities.
• Proficiency in MS Office (Excel, Power Point, Word) is required.
• Bilingual - Korean and English (written, spoken) required.
